Directions:
Sat nav: BN45 7FR
What 3 words: ///cloak.dined.shepherds
By car:
Travelling south on the A23 from Gatwick take the exit towards the A273 towards Hassocks. At the T junction turn right and follow the road until you reach the Plough Pub on your left. Turn immediately left around this corner and drive up Church Lane till you come to a cross roads by the Church. Turn left onto Church Hill and you will see The Forge directly ahead.
Drive past the house to the long black gate opposite the church entrance. Pull open the gate (it is not electric) and park directly in front of the garage doors. Our blue camper van may be in the drive on the right hand side but unless you have a large vehicle (short wheel base is fine) you will be able to swing round it to park to the left of it, ensuring there is still space for us to reverse out! There is parking for just one vehicle so if you have two vehicles there is free parking just as you come onto Church Hill (you can also park there if you wish).
If travelling from Brighton on the A23 take the slip road towards Hassocks A273 going under the flyover. Take the first exit on the left towards the BP Garage/M&S. You will see the Plough pub and Pyecombe sign ahead of you. Turn right just infront of the pub and go up Church Lane to the crossroads at the top. Follow above instructions from there.
Walking/Cycling:
We are directly on the South Downs Way so you can’t miss us! If walking west to east we are the first house in Pyecombe you see when walking up Church Hill. If walking east to west go up School Lane then at the crossroads keep straight and we are opposite the church. Please slide open the long black gate opposite the church gate and The Stables are on your left.
Train and Bus/Uber:
The nearest station is Hassocks which is on the London to Brighton train line.
From Hassocks Stonepound you can get the 270, 271, 272 or 273 Metrobus (please see their website for times https://www.metrobus.co.uk ) to Pyecombe. It will stop opposite the M&S garage so you can walk up Church Lane by The Plough pub from there 5-10 minutes. If you are travelling from Brighton by bus it will stop on the A273 just pass the garage so walk back on yourself towards The Plough.
Please note it is not possible to walk to/from Hassocks station due to no footpaths.
Alternatively you can get an Uber taxi from Hassocks or Brighton station.
